WCAG Reference:
4.1.3 Status Messages (Level AA)
Understanding Status Messages |How to Meet Status Messages
Issue ID: DAC_Status_Messages_01
URL: https://ukhodataupload.admiralty.co.uk/external/survey-details
Page title: Survey Details
Journey: 1.3
Live error messages and the error summary is not adequately relayed to screen reader
users. This instance can be found when causing errors on the page or attempting to
continue onto the next stage of the service with required feels left empty. Error messages
and the error summary can be viewed; however, an adequate role is missing from the
components to relay this information to screen reader users when they are displayed
Status Messages Errors presented visually are not relayed programmatically.
